Job Description

Capitol Strategies Consulting, Inc in Springfield, IL is seeking Sr. Storage Administrators to apply knowledge of database administration & computer information systems theories, principles and concepts, as well as experience with storage administration operations to perform the following duties: 
 
1.   Oversee, administer and manage storage operations in a heterogeneous SAN/Blue arc NAS storage in huge environment distributed into multiple datacenters consisting of HDS/HP and EMC arrays and Cisco, Brocade fabric. 
2.   Dynamic pool creations and thin provisioning to ARE/Windows/Unix hosts and RAID configurations for OPEN Systems from HDS USPVM/VSP. 
3.   Monitor the Storage Subsystems for any performance issues on a daily basis and performed the tuning if needed using the HDS Tuning Manager. 
4.   Monitor HNAS system thresholds and took proactive measure to prevent outages. 
5.   Perform switch related maintenance activities such as Module replacements. 
6.   Assign the SAN Storage LUNs to Servers from Hitachi USP/USP-V/VSP/AMS to open systems and trouble shoot all storage issues related to LUNs assignment. 
7.   Troubleshooting HDS/HP errors and connectivity issues with SAN fabric consists of Cisco MDS Switches working with vendors to fix or replace the hardware. 
8.   Lead role in Cisco DMM migration for servers from USP/USP-V to new VSP storage subsystems. 
9.   Perform day to day troubleshooting tasks for SAN environment. 
10.   Work on reclamation of unused storage using performance reports. 
11.   Schedule and monitor the firmware upgrades for HDS and HP storage arrays. 
12.   Installation, administration and troubleshoot of multipath software on open systems. 
13.   Generate reports through storage scope with relevant to capacity planning, 
14.   Trouble shooting with path failing / zone modifications. 
15.   Coordinating with business ends for resolving issues relevant to SAN. 
16.   On-call support for SAN infrastructures and storage services. 


Minimum requirements: 

Bachelor’s degree in Computer Information Systems, Database Administration, Computer Science, Computer Applications or related field and at least five (5) years of post-degree, progressively responsible experience in job-offered or related position(s). 
 
Qualified applicant must also have demonstrable proficiency, skill, experience and knowledge with the following: 
1.   Storage provisioning tasks such as Zoning & LUN security; 
2.   Allocated storage to heterogeneous hosts; 
3.   SAN Fabric Zoning on Cisco MDS Switches/Brocade fabric (CLI/Fabric manager); 
4.   Thin provisioning creations and RAID configurations;  
5.   Design/planning/managing VERITAS Netback Manager Server; 
6.   Troubleshooting HP/EVA errors and connectivity issues with SAN fabric.
